Licence Check: Verifying Your Operator’s Credentials
Before depositing any money, you should always verify that the operator holds a valid licence from the UK Gambling Commission (UKGC). This is your primary protection as a player. You can check any operator’s licence on the UKGC’s public register at gamblingcommission.gov.uk. Simply search for the company name (e.g., ‘Lindar Media Ltd’ for MrQ, ‘Bonne Terre Gaming’ for Sky Vegas) and confirm their licence number is active. A valid UKGC licence ensures the operator adheres to strict standards on fairness, player protection, and anti-money laundering. It also gives you access to the UKGC’s dispute resolution services if something goes wrong. If a site claims to be ‘licensed in the UK’ but you cannot find them on the register, don’t play there. Offshore operators are not covered by UK consumer protections and may not offer the same level of safety. Disputes and Complaints: Your Rights as a Player
Even with the best operators, disputes can sometimes arise. If you have a complaint about a UKGC-licensed site, your first step is to contact their customer support team directly. Most issues, such as delayed withdrawals or bonus disputes, can be resolved at this stage. If the operator fails to resolve your complaint within eight weeks, you can escalate the matter to an Alternative Dispute Resolution (ADR) provider. The most common ADR for UK gambling is IBAS (Independent Betting Adjudication Service).
IBAS will review your case independently and make a binding decision. If IBAS rules in your favour, the operator must comply. If the operator refuses to comply, you can then take your complaint to the UK Gambling Commission, which has the power to revoke the operator’s licence. This multi-layered system of protection is a significant advantage of playing at UKGC-licensed sites. It ensures that players have a clear path to justice, which isn’t available at unlicensed or offshore casinos.

What does ‘wager-free’ mean for bingo free spins?
Wager-free means any winnings from your free spins are credited directly to your cash balance with no playthrough requirement. You can withdraw them immediately or use them to play other games. This is the most player-friendly type of bonus available.
